pub struct DynamicStoreRunLoopSource { /* private fields */ }Expand description
Re-exports the corresponding SystemConfiguration wrappers.
Wraps the CFRunLoopSourceRef created by SCDynamicStoreCreateRunLoopSource.
Implementations§
Source§impl DynamicStoreRunLoopSource
impl DynamicStoreRunLoopSource
Sourcepub fn schedule_current_default_mode(&self) -> Result<()>
pub fn schedule_current_default_mode(&self) -> Result<()>
Wraps SCRunLoopSourceScheduleCurrentDefaultMode.
Sourcepub fn unschedule_current_default_mode(&self) -> Result<()>
pub fn unschedule_current_default_mode(&self) -> Result<()>
Wraps SCRunLoopSourceUnscheduleCurrentDefaultMode.
Trait Implementations§
Source§impl Clone for DynamicStoreRunLoopSource
impl Clone for DynamicStoreRunLoopSource
Source§fn clone(&self) -> DynamicStoreRunLoopSource
fn clone(&self) -> DynamicStoreRunLoopSource
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for DynamicStoreRunLoopSource
impl RefUnwindSafe for DynamicStoreRunLoopSource
impl !Send for DynamicStoreRunLoopSource
impl !Sync for DynamicStoreRunLoopSource
impl Unpin for DynamicStoreRunLoopSource
impl UnsafeUnpin for DynamicStoreRunLoopSource
impl UnwindSafe for DynamicStoreRunLoopSource
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more